Porsche has been noticed testing a high-riding 911 Safari over the previous 12 months, however this isn’t that car. What you are taking a look at is a specifically developed 911 off-roader constructed to deal with the world’s tallest volcano, Chile’s Ojos del Salado, which has its summit at 22,615 toes.
Porsche constructed two of the rugged 911s, each primarily based on the Carrera 4S. They have been pushed by a workforce led by endurance racer and adventurer Romain Dumas to discover the boundaries of the 911. Dumas and his workforce reached a top of 19,708 toes, which is spectacular given the skinny air, temperatures as little as -22 levels F, and a whole absence of roads.
The best a car has pushed up the volcano is 21,961.94 toes, set by a pair of Mercedes-Benz Unimogs in 2020. That determine is an altitude file for climb achieved by a wheeled car.

Tasked with making a low-slung sports activities automotive just like the 911 able to dealing with the rocky and icy terrain of the volcano’s slopes was Michael Rösler, chief engineer for the 911.
The automotive’s engine, a twin-turbo 3.0-liter flat-6 rated at 443 hp, was already capable of cope nicely with the skinny air, which is about half as dense as air at sea stage. Because of this, the first focus was on modifications designed to deal with the tough terrain.
The important thing modification have been portal axles, which elevated floor clearance to virtually 14 inches and required widened wheel arches to be fitted. The 911’s 7-speed guide transmission stays, however was given decrease gear ratios to permit for exact, light throttle inputs at low velocity. The brand new ratios additionally work nicely with the big, off-road tires that have been fitted, in line with Porsche.

Porsche additionally put in a tool referred to as a Warp-Connecter. Tailored from motorsports, the machine permits fixed wheel hundreds even when the chassis experiences excessive actions, and because of this, it improves traction. Differential locks and a steer-by-wire system have been additionally added.
For security, the automobiles have been fitted with roll cages, carbon-fiber bucket seats, harnesses, and a winch. Underbody safety, produced from Aramid fiber, was additionally put in to permit sliding over rocks.
Whereas Porsche would not plan to place into manufacturing a 911 this rugged, the automaker is anticipated to launch a extra succesful model within the close to future. Prototypes noticed within the wild featured a taller journey top and stuck rear wing.
